Transaction bab34aa7067062584b8e94e81c207a4b39abb99148f1768546e0a9124ceb14c2
1 Input
1 Output
-
bab34aa7067062584b8e94e81c207a4b39abb99148f1768546e0a9124ceb14c2:0
- value
- 644768
- script pubkey
- OP_0 OP_PUSHBYTES_20 9344c0d23107d5566a0376addd3e0f8dd255b151
- address
- bc1qjdzvp533ql24v6srw6ka60s03hf9tv23nfahaf